VC funding has dropped. Is actually bootstrapping the option?

.The pinnacle of VC financing has actually pertained to a side as well as the effect is actually a fairly bleak image for striving entrepreneurs. Documents present that worldwide equity capital backing dropped 30% in the very first one-fourth of 2024-- the second-lowest quarter on file for global start-up funding since very early 2018. Because of this, several business owners are returning to a trustworthy, however indisputably challenging, course to introducing a prosperous start-up that does not call for funding: bootstrapping. It might be a slower climb, however in my knowledge, the liberty as well as sustainability have actually been well worth it. Not only that, a recent record from start-up loan provider Capchase discovered that today, bootstrapped services are actually expanding as quick as venture-backed startups. They're additionally investing a quarter of what their VC-backed equivalents spend on customer acquisition. As any sort of business owner will certainly tell you: maintaining the expenses of acquiring consumers down is a primary consider long-lasting sustainable growth. I am never claiming that bootstrapping is effortless. And many business people are not in a financial ranking to utilize their very own funds to begin a business. However if you're asking yourself whether to shake your hat in the startup band, in spite of the state of VC financing, listed here are actually three reasons bootstrapping may be a resource, certainly not a responsibility, for your service. Less prone to economic ups and downs There's a reason start-ups bunch hack full weeks and also layout sprints: restrictions mandate efficiency as well as productivity kinds innovation. Bootstrappers are actually educated in efficiency coming from day one. Without the luxurious of outside funding, bootstrappers do not spend on requirements. They focus on the vital-- why lease an elegant office space if you can build your 1st item coming from home? When you are bootstrapping an organization, there is no area for surplus. Bootstrappers need to select which expenditures of funds and time will certainly move the needle. As the Capchase record reveals, development and also earnings do not stem from devoting endless funding on achievement. As an alternative, it's from "knowing which levers drive the largest effect." The final number of years have viewed economical ups and also downs. As well as if one of the most latest downturn had any sort of takeaways, one is actually that bootstrappers are actually extra steady in tough times. Bootstrapped startups are commonly less anxious about moneying drying up and also needing to make large slashes to advertising budget plans and working with. Bootstrapping business owners are currently accustomed to concentrating on all-time low line and just how to raise income. We are actually made use of to living within our means due to the fact that our experts don't understand every other way.Reassurance for workers When I launched my business, I was actually the only employee. I used all the hats, from marketing and human resources to product layout and troubleshooting. Taking a page from some of my advisors, I made a guideline for myself. I will simply work with additional employees when some of the hats came to be also heavy (definition I could not carry out the job and also carry on developing the company) and also merely when I had a year's wage for the brand-new hire in the financial institution. Almost two decades later, we possess 660 staff members as well as counting. Yet development was actually slow. There were no working with crazes. Meanwhile, our team also avoided shooting excitements. That is a major selling point for our business when questioning leading ability. Our team attract workers considering keeping (and also increasing) along with the business, a remarkable factor when technician companies are actually draining proficient employees. Slow, careful growth prevents spikes and also drops in your staff. One more commonly overlooked perk of developing little by little is actually that you can naturally develop an authentic team culture. There is actually space to make errors as well as right training courses as you go. You can know what you market value as well as what your individuals appreciate. While ping-pong tables and also unlimited treats don't injured, I've found that folks are actually a lot more curious about benefiting firms that worth them as varied folks as well as are acquired their advancement. Laser-focus on the best significant stakeholdersWhen company obtains tough, be it a harsh economic climate or even a competitor like Google.com entering your niche, the preliminary emotion can be panic. As a founder, your instinct might be to scurry to carry out one thing major, like a fancy advertising initiative or even a bold brand-new item. If you possess the spending plan, then why not? However along with minimal sources, you can not automatically take those significant (as well as typically sensitive) measures. I've learned that there is actually terrific market value in not doing anything whatsoever-- except listening. Paying attention to individuals as well as understanding their demands is the most impactful, minimum costly initiative. It allows you to go into the information, aggravate out definition, and also understand your true value proposal. There is actually no quick way, certainly not also an AI tool, for developing an extensive understanding of your firm and your individuals. Bootstrapping makes certain that you earn your entrepreneurial red stripes. Consider it the beautiful course versus the expressway. It's a much longer street but I feel it promises a more enriching experience.
